Understanding the German B1 Certificate: A Gateway to Advanced Language Proficiency
The German B1 Certificate, frequently described as the "Zertifikat Deutsch B1," is a significant turning point for students of the German language. This accreditation, which becomes part of the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), signifies a level of proficiency that allows people to communicate efficiently in a wide variety of everyday and expert scenarios. This post looks into the significance of the B1 certificate, the assessment process, and tips for preparation.
What is the German B1 Certificate?
The German B1 Certificate is a globally recognized language qualification that vouches for a student's capability to comprehend and use German in a range of contexts. At the B1 level, people can:
Understand the bottom lines of clear basic input on familiar matters frequently encountered in work, school, leisure, and so on.Handle the majority of situations most likely to develop while traveling in an area where the language is spoken.Produce basic linked text on topics that are familiar or of personal interest.Describe experiences and occasions, dreams, hopes, and ambitions, and briefly give reasons and descriptions for opinions and plans.Value of the B1 Certificate

The Examination Process
The German B1 Certificate assessment is developed to examine the candidate's proficiency in all 4 language skills: reading, composing, listening, and speaking. The test is usually divided into the following sections:

Reading Comprehension:
Format: Candidates read a series of texts and address multiple-choice concerns.Abilities Assessed: Ability to understand and translate composed details, consisting of articles, letters, and narratives.
Composing:
Format: Candidates write a short essay or letter based on a provided timely.Abilities Assessed: Ability to reveal ideas clearly and coherently in written kind, with correct grammar and vocabulary.
Listening:
Format: Candidates listen to audio recordings and respond to concerns based on what they hear.Skills Assessed: Ability to understand spoken German in different contexts, consisting of discussions, announcements, and interviews.
Speaking:
Format: Candidates take part in a structured conversation with an examiner.Skills Assessed: Ability to communicate successfully in spoken German, consisting of expressing opinions, asking and addressing questions, and describing situations.Preparation Tips

Frequently asked questions
Q: How long does it take to get ready for the B1 examination?

A: The time required to prepare for the B1 examination varies depending upon the individual's starting level and the intensity of their study. Normally, it can take several months of consistent practice to reach the B1 level.

Q: Can I retake the B1 evaluation if I fail?

A: Yes, you can retake the B1 evaluation if you do not pass. It is recommended to recognize the areas where you require improvement and focus on those before retaking the test.

Q: Are there various variations of the B1 certificate for various purposes?

Q: Is the B1 certificate legitimate for life?

A: The B1 certificate is normally considered valid for life, however some institutions may require you to take a new test if a significant quantity of time has actually passed because your initial accreditation.

Q: Can I use the B1 certificate for visa applications?

A: Yes, the B1 certificate is frequently accepted as evidence of language proficiency for visa applications to German-speaking nations. However, it is constantly a good idea to check the particular requirements of the embassy or consulate.
